Sidewalk Repair in Miami Dade County, FL
Sidewalk repair services involve fixing and restoring damaged or uneven concrete walkways to ensure safety, accessibility, and visual appeal. Projects typically include addressing cracks, chips, and surface wear, as well as leveling uneven sections caused by ground shifting or settling. Property owners often seek these services to prevent tripping hazards, comply with local ordinances, or improve curb appeal, especially when sidewalks show signs of deterioration or damage from weather and regular use.
Before requesting sidewalk repair, property owners should consider the extent of the damage, the age of the existing concrete, and any underlying issues such as soil movement or drainage problems. It’s helpful to understand the scope of work needed, whether it involves simple patching or complete replacement, and to be aware of local regulations regarding sidewalk modifications. Clear communication about the condition of the sidewalk and desired outcomes can facilitate a smooth repair process.

Common Sidewalk Repair Jobs
Sidewalk Repair - addresses cracks, holes, and uneven surfaces for safety and accessibility.
Concrete Resurfacing - restores worn or damaged sidewalk surfaces to improve appearance and durability.
Joint Repair - fixes cracked or separated expansion joints to prevent further damage.
Sidewalk Replacement - replaces severely damaged sections to ensure a smooth, level walking surface.
Trip Hazard Removal - eliminates uneven areas that pose safety risks for pedestrians.
Concrete Leveling - raises sunken sidewalk sections to restore proper grade and prevent water pooling.
Sidewalk Repair Questions
What signs indicate sidewalk damage? Cracks, uneven surfaces, or raised sections are common signs of sidewalk issues that may need repair.
Why is sidewalk repair important? Repairing damaged sidewalks helps prevent accidents and maintains the property's appearance and value.
What types of sidewalk projects are typically requested? Common projects include fixing cracks, leveling uneven slabs, and replacing broken sections.
How should property owners prepare for sidewalk repair? Clear the area around the sidewalk and inform the contractor of any specific concerns or access needs.
